Circular polarization selective aluminum nano-spirals at ultraviolet wavelengths

Matthew S. Davis, Jared Strait, Jay K. Lee, Steve Blair, Amit Agrawal, Henri J. Lezec

Research output: Chapter in Book/Entry/PoemConference contribution

Abstract

Manipulating ultraviolet light presents unique challenges in technology. Here we demonstrate circular polarization selection at ultraviolet wavelengths over subwavelength distances using a flat-optical device consisting of Al chiral nanospirals periodically patterned on a glass substrate.
